IPC Subgroup
H02P 27/1

using bang-bang controllers

Introduced: January 2006

Full Title

Arrangements or methods for the control of AC motors characterised by the kind of supply voltage > using variable-frequency supply voltage, e.g. inverter or converter supply voltage > using DC to AC converters or inverters > with pulse width modulation > using bang-bang controllers

Classification Context

Section:
ELECTRICITY
Class:
GENERATION, CONVERSION, OR DISTRIBUTION OF ELECTRIC POWER
Subclass:
CONTROL OR REGULATION OF ELECTRIC MOTORS, ELECTRIC GENERATORS OR DYNAMO-ELECTRIC CONVERTERS; CONTROLLING TRANSFORMERS, REACTORS OR CHOKE COILS

Scope Notes

Glossary: bang-bang controller (on-off controller) is also known as a hysteresis controller, is a feedback controller that switches abruptly between two states
